Hotel cited for mentoring skills tilt participants

Sunnexdesk

THE Technical Education and Skills Development Authority (Tesda) in Central Visayas recognized Waterfront Cebu City Hotel and Casino (WCCH) for mentoring the victors of the regional skills competition held on Jan. 27 to 30.

Ma. Alyzza Albon of Siquijor and Neriza B. Mahinay of Bohol, winners of the regional skills competition, observed the processes in restaurant services and cookery at WCCH.

With the winners’ desire to stand out at the Philippine National Skills Competition, which took place last April 8 to 11 in Metro Manila, Tesda 7 tapped Waterfront Cebu City Hotel and Casino to allow the contestants for an industry immersion within the hotel premises to gain more experience in the actual workplace.

During the national competition, Ma. Alyzza Albon of Siquijor received an award with distinction for her exceptional performance in the field of restaurant services.

Tesda 7 awarded the certificate of appreciation to the hotel for helping out the representatives from Central Visayas to succeed in their tour trade areas during the competitaion.

WCCH actively participates in such efforts to further strengthen and promote the hospitality skills of budding tourism professionals in the region.
